Abstract
The utility model relates to an eccentric link rod yarn pressing plate mechanism. Each eccentric link rod mechanism is installed on a base plate of a machine through a link rod frame, wherein a yarn pressing main swing arm is fixed with the machine and one end of the yarn pressing main swing arm is connected with an eccentric drawing rod through a link rod, the other end of the yarn pressing main swing arm is connected with a yarn pressing auxiliary swing arm, a swing arm of the yarn pressing plate and the yarn pressing auxiliary swing arm are both fixed on a swing shaft of the yarn pressing plate, a yarn pressing sliding rod is connected with the swing arm of the yarn pressing plate through a displacement compensation plate, a guiding base of the yarn pressing plate is fixed on the machine, a yarn pressing plate is fixed on the sliding rod of the yarn pressing plate, the sliding rod of the yarn pressing plate moves in the direction of guiding holes of the yarn pressing plate so as to drive the yarn pressing plate to proceed yarn-pressing operation, and two sets of the eccentric link rod mechanisms are respectively arranged at two ends of the machine. According to the eccentric link rod yarn pressing plate mechanism, yarn pressing plate transmission devices are distributed at two ends of the machine. The eccentric link rod yarn pressing plate mechanism is characterized by simple structure, stable transmission and processing convenience.

Background technology
Existing schlagblech mechanism by the conjugate cam mechanism that is distributed in machine one end, realizes the side-to-side movement of connecting rod, further realizes moving up and down of schlagblech.The maximum characteristics of this transmission are exactly simple for structure, but this mechanism exists following defective and deficiency: roller contacts for line with the conjugate cam surface, and it is big in motion process, to wear and tear, and service life is short; The processing difficulties of conjugate cam, machining accuracy are not high; Speed of related movement between cam and the roller is limited, the difficult high-speed cruising of realizing, and cam mechanism is distributed in an end of machine, and machine is long more, and transmission is just more not steady.
